Frequently Asked Questions

Can I fit 18 inch black rims on my car if it originally had 17 inch wheels?

Yes, most vehicles can accommodate an 18 inch rim if the offset and bolt pattern match, but you should verify clearance for brakes and suspension components.

Do black rims require special cleaning to keep the finish looking good?

Black finishes benefit from regular washing with mild soap and a non‑abrasive polish; avoid harsh chemicals that can dull the coating.

Will a heavier rim affect my fuel economy?

Heavier rims increase unsprung weight, which can slightly reduce fuel efficiency and affect handling; lighter forged wheels generally improve both.

What bolt pattern should I look for when choosing a rim?

Match the wheel’s bolt pattern (e.g., 5×114.3) to your vehicle’s specification; using the wrong pattern can lead to unsafe mounting.

Is it safe to install rims without a professional?

While many owners can mount rims with basic tools, having a qualified technician torque the lug nuts to manufacturer specifications ensures safety.
